[0001] The utility model relates to the technical field of suspension conveyors, in particular to an accumulation type suspension conveyor. Background Art

[0002] The power-and-free overhead conveyor is a three-dimensional closed-loop continuous conveying system suitable for the automated transport of finished goods within and between workshops. It is widely used in modern industrial production in industries such as machinery, automobiles, steel rolling, aluminum smelting, light industry, home appliances, chemicals, and building materials.

[0003] The accumulation type overhead conveyor in the prior art suspends the workpiece on the conveying vehicle group through hooks when in use. However, when suspending larger workpieces, multiple hooks are needed to fix the workpiece together. However, different workpieces have different sizes, which requires adjusting the relative positions between the hooks to achieve stable suspension of the workpiece. However, in the prior art, the hooks are fixedly connected to the conveying vehicle group through iron chains. In order to be suitable for workpieces of different sizes, additional hooks need to be set up, which increases the transportation cost and the hooks that do not suspend the workpiece will also affect the suspension of the workpiece, thereby affecting the transportation efficiency of the workpiece. [0044] The working principle and beneficial effects of the utility model are as follows:

[0045] 1. In the present invention, by providing the first relative movement mechanism, the operation of the first motor can control the rotation of the driving column, and the sliding fit between the driving column and the driving tube drives the driving tube and the second bevel gear to rotate. At the same time, the meshing of the second bevel gear and the first bevel gear can drive the bidirectional threaded rod to rotate, and the threaded fit between the bidirectional threaded rod and the first threaded hole drives the fixed housing to move relative to each other, thereby adjusting the relative position between the hooks on the two fixed housings.

[0046] 2 In the utility model, through the setting of the second relative movement mechanism, the operation of the electric push rod can control the push plate and the drive tube to move, so that the first bevel gear and the second bevel gear can be brought into contact and meshed relationship and the sixth bevel gear can be meshed with the fifth bevel gear. At this time, the first motor is kept working, so that the rotation of the fixed tube can drive the sixth bevel gear to rotate, and at the same time, the meshing of the fifth bevel gear and the sixth bevel gear drives the drive rod to rotate, and then the cooperation of the slider and the slide groove drives the fourth bevel gear to rotate, and the meshing of the fourth bevel gear and the third bevel gear can drive the two second threaded rods in the fixed housing to rotate in the opposite direction, thereby driving the two hooks on the fixed housing to move relative to each other, thereby facilitating the position adjustment of the hooks.

[0047] 3. In the present invention, through the arrangement of the rail, the conveying vehicle group, the supporting shell, the supporting port, the fixed shell, the fixed groove, the fixed block, the first relative movement mechanism and the second relative movement mechanism, it is convenient to drive the two fixed shells and the hooks on the two fixed shells to move relative to each other through the operation of the first relative movement mechanism, and the two hooks on the fixed shells can be driven to move relative to each other through the operation of the second relative movement mechanism, thereby realizing the adjustment of the relative positions of the hooks, solving the problem of low efficiency in suspending workpieces of different sizes in the related art. [0055] like Figure 1-Figure 4 As shown, this embodiment proposes a accumulating type suspended conveyor, including a track 1, a conveying car group 2, a supporting shell 3, a supporting port, a fixed shell 4, a fixed groove 5, a fixed block 6, a first relative movement mechanism and a second relative movement mechanism, the conveying car group 2 is slidably arranged on the track 1, the supporting shell 3 is arranged on one side of the conveying car group 2, two fixed plates are fixedly arranged between the supporting shell 3 and the conveying car group 2, the supporting port is opened on the inner bottom wall of the supporting shell 3, two fixed shells 4 are slidably arranged in the supporting shell 3, two fixed grooves 5 are respectively opened on both sides of the bottom wall of the fixed shell 4, the fixed block 6 is slidably arranged in the fixed groove 5, an iron chain is fixed on the fixed block 6, and a hook is fixed on the iron chain, the first relative movement mechanism is arranged in the supporting shell 3, for controlling the relative movement of the two fixed shells 4, and the second relative movement mechanism is arranged in the fixed shell 4, for controlling the relative movement of the two fixed blocks 6 in the same fixed shell 4.

[0056] Reference Figure 2 and Figure 4, the first relative movement mechanism includes a first threaded hole, a bidirectional threaded rod 7 and a synchronous rotation mechanism. Two first threaded holes are respectively provided on the two fixed shells 4. Two bidirectional threaded rods 7 are rotatably provided in the support shell 3. The bidirectional threaded rods 7 pass through the first threaded holes through threaded cooperation. The synchronous rotation mechanism is provided in the support shell 3 for controlling the two bidirectional threaded rods 7 to rotate synchronously. The synchronous rotation mechanism includes a first cavity 8, a first bevel gear 9, a drive tube 10 and a power input mechanism. The first cavity 8 is provided in the support shell 3. Two first bevel gears 9 are rotatably provided on the side wall of the first cavity 8. The first bevel gear The wheel 9 is fixedly connected to the bidirectional threaded rod 7, the drive tube 10 is arranged in the first cavity 8, and the second bevel gears 11 are fixedly provided at both ends of the side walls of the drive tube 10. The second bevel gear 11 is engaged with the first bevel gear 9. The power input mechanism is arranged in the first cavity 8 and is used to control the rotation of the drive tube 10. The power input mechanism includes a drive column 12 and a first motor 13. The drive column 12 is rotatably arranged in the first cavity 8. The drive column 12 passes through the drive tube 10 and is slidably connected to the inner wall of the drive tube 10. The first motor 13 is fixedly provided on the support shell 3, and the output end of the first motor 13 is fixedly connected to the drive column 12.

[0057] Specifically, the operator controls the operation of the first motor 13, and the operation of the first motor 13 can control the rotation of the driving column 12, and at the same time, the sliding fit relationship between the driving column 12 and the driving tube 10 drives the driving tube 10 and the second bevel gear 11 to rotate. At the same time, the engagement of the second bevel gear 11 with the first bevel gear 9 can drive the bidirectional threaded rod 7 to rotate, and then the threaded fit between the bidirectional threaded rod 7 and the first threaded hole drives the fixed shell 4 to move relative to each other, and then the relative position between the hooks on the two fixed shells 4 is adjusted.

[0058] Reference Figure 3 and Figure 4, the second relative movement mechanism includes a second threaded hole, a second threaded rod 14 and a reverse rotation mechanism. A second threaded hole is opened on the fixed block 6, and the second threaded rod 14 is rotatably set in the fixed groove 5. The second threaded rod 14 passes through the second threaded hole by threaded cooperation. The reverse rotation mechanism is arranged in the fixed housing 4, and is used to control the two second threaded rods 14 on the fixed housing 4 to rotate in the opposite direction. The reverse rotation mechanism includes a third bevel gear 15, a fourth bevel gear 16 and a driving mechanism. The third bevel gear 15 is rotatably set on the side wall of the fixed housing 4 close to the second threaded rod 14. The third bevel gear 15 is fixedly connected to the second threaded rod 14. The fourth bevel gear 16 is rotatably set on the side wall of the fixed housing 4. The fourth bevel gear 16 and the third bevel gear The gears 15 are engaged, and the driving mechanism is arranged in the supporting shell 3, and is used to control the two fourth bevel gears 16 to rotate synchronously. The driving mechanism includes a first driving port, a second driving port, a driving rod 17 and a power transmission mechanism. The first driving port is opened on the side wall of the fixed shell 4, and the second driving port is opened on the fourth bevel gear 16. The driving rod 17 is rotatably arranged in the supporting shell 3. The driving rod 17 passes through the first driving port and the second driving port. The driving rod 17 is slidingly connected to the side wall of the second driving port. The power transmission mechanism is arranged in the first cavity 8, and is used to control the rotation of the driving rod 17. The side wall of the driving rod 17 is provided with a slide groove 18, and the side wall of the second driving port is fixedly provided with a slider, which extends into the slide groove 18 and is slidingly connected to the side wall of the slide groove 18.

[0059] Specifically, the rotation of the driving rod 17 can drive the slide groove 18 to rotate, and the cooperation between the slider and the slide groove 18 can drive the fourth bevel gear 16 to rotate. The engagement of the fourth bevel gear 16 and the third bevel gear 15 can drive the two second threaded rods 14 in the fixed housing 4 to rotate in the opposite direction, thereby driving the two hooks on the fixed housing 4 to move relative to each other, thereby realizing the position adjustment of the hooks.

[0060] Reference Figure 4 The power transmission mechanism includes a fifth bevel gear 19 and a sixth bevel gear 20. The fifth bevel gear 19 is rotatably arranged on the side wall of the first cavity 8. The fifth bevel gear 19 is fixedly connected to the driving rod 17. The sixth bevel gear 20 is fixedly arranged on the side wall of the driving tube 10. The sixth bevel gear 20 is engaged with the fifth bevel gear 19. It also includes a push plate 21. Two push plates 21 are slidably arranged in the first cavity 8. A through-hole is opened on the push plate 21. Both ends of the driving tube 10 extend into the through-hole and are slidably connected to the side wall of the through-hole. An electric push rod 22 is fixedly arranged on the side wall of the support shell 3, and the output end of the electric push rod 22 is fixedly connected to the push plate 21.

[0061] Specifically, the operator controls the operation of the electric push rod 22, and the operation of the electric push rod 22 can control the push plate 21 and the drive tube 10 to move, so that the first bevel gear 9 and the second bevel gear 11 can be in contact and meshing relationship and the sixth bevel gear 20 can be meshed with the fifth bevel gear 19. At this time, the first motor 13 is kept working, so that the rotation of the fixed tube can drive the sixth bevel gear 20 to rotate, and at the same time, the drive rod 17 is driven to rotate through the meshing of the fifth bevel gear 19 and the sixth bevel gear 20.

[0062] In this embodiment, when in use, the operator controls the first motor 13 to work, and the operation of the first motor 13 can control the driving column 12 to rotate, and at the same time, the sliding fit relationship between the driving column 12 and the driving tube 10 drives the driving tube 10 and the second bevel gear 11 to rotate, and at the same time, the engagement of the second bevel gear 11 with the first bevel gear 9 can drive the bidirectional threaded rod 7 to rotate, and then the threaded fit between the bidirectional threaded rod 7 and the first threaded hole drives the fixed shell 4 to move relative to each other, thereby adjusting the relative position between the hooks on the two fixed shells 4, and then the operator controls the electric push rod 22 to work, and the operation of the electric push rod 22 can control the push plate 21 and the driving tube 10 to move, so that the first The bevel gear 9 is in contact and meshing relationship with the second bevel gear 11 and makes the sixth bevel gear 20 mesh with the fifth bevel gear 19. At this time, the first motor 13 is kept working, so that the rotation of the fixed tube can drive the sixth bevel gear 20 to rotate, and at the same time, the engagement of the fifth bevel gear 19 and the sixth bevel gear 20 drives the driving rod 17 to rotate. At this time, the fourth bevel gear 16 is driven to rotate by the cooperation of the slider and the slide groove 18. The engagement of the fourth bevel gear 16 and the third bevel gear 15 can drive the two second threaded rods 14 in the fixed housing 4 to rotate in the opposite direction, thereby driving the two hooks on the fixed housing 4 to move relative to each other, so that the position of the hook can be adjusted, so that workpieces of different sizes can be suspended by the hook.
